The Core Mechanics at a Glance
- Betting Phase: Set your stake and pick a difficulty level—Easy (24 steps), Medium (22 steps), Hard (20 steps), or Hardcore (15 steps).
- Crossing Phase: Your chicken moves one step at a time across a grid that hides manhole covers and ovens.
- Decision Phase: After each step, you choose to continue or cash out.
- Resolution Phase: If you hit a trap, your round ends immediately; if you cash out before that, you win the accumulated multiplier.
The visual style is cartoonish and colorful, with traffic elements adding atmosphere but no distracting noise. A clean interface displays your current multiplier prominently, so you can gauge risk in real time.

Choosing the Right Difficulty for Rapid Sessions
Selecting an appropriate difficulty level is perhaps the most critical decision for any player looking to maximize quick outcomes. Each level modifies both the number of steps available and the probability of encountering traps.
The four available modes are:
- Easy (24 steps): Lowest risk; best for frequent small wins.
- Medium (22 steps): Balanced risk/reward; suitable for casual players wanting moderate payouts.
- Hard (20 steps): Higher risk; offers larger multipliers if you survive.
- Hardcore (15 steps): Maximum risk; high probability of loss per step but potential for huge payouts.
For short sessions where you want quick highs without prolonged playtime, many find that Medium or Hard levels strike an optimal balance—enough risk to keep things exciting but not so much that you lose too often during those rapid rounds.

Risk Management in Short, Intense Rounds
A disciplined risk strategy feels like a secret weapon when playing short bursts of Chicken Road. Because each round offers instant feedback—either victory or loss—the temptation to chase big payouts can quickly erode your bankroll if left unchecked.
The following bullet points outline practical risk controls tailored for rapid sessions:
- Bet Size: Keep each wager between 1% and 3% of your total bankroll to preserve capital across multiple short rounds.
- Session Limits: Decide beforehand how much you’re willing to spend in any given session—say €5 for quick play—and stop once reached.
- Win Targets: Set realistic profit goals (e.g., double your session stake) before you begin; once achieved, walk away.
- Panic Stops: If you experience two consecutive losses within the same difficulty level, switch to an easier mode or pause temporarily.
This framework helps maintain emotional control and keeps each decision grounded in strategy rather than reactionary impulses—a vital approach when every round lasts only seconds.
